There are several varieties of uPVC door panels offered that deal with different requirements and choices. Below are some common types:
Solid uPVC Panels: These panels are developed for resilience and security.
Foam-Filled Panels: With insulation homes, these panels assist keep the indoor temperature.
Double-Glazed Panels: These panels consist of 2 layers of glass, supplying additional sound insulation and energy efficiency.
French and Patio Door Panels: Designed for bigger openings, these panels provide expansive views and smooth shifts between inside your home and outdoors.
Composite Panels: Combining wood and uPVC, these panels offer the classic look of wood with the benefits of uPVC.

Picking uPVC door panels features many advantages, making them appealing for both domestic and business applications.
Weather Resistance: uPVC panels do not warp or rot, making them resistant to rain, humidity, and severe temperatures.
Energy Efficiency: Most uPVC doors are developed with thermal insulation, helping in reducing energy usage and expenses.
Visual Versatility: Available in a variety of colors and finishes, uPVC panels can perfectly match any architectural design.
Cost-Effectiveness: While initial costs might differ, their longevity and low maintenance requirements make them a cost-efficient investment in time.
Eco-Friendly Options: Many uPVC panels are now made from recycled materials, including an eco-friendly element to their appeal.

Maintenance Tips for uPVC Door Panels
Correct maintenance is crucial to ensuring the durability of uPVC door panels. Here are some ideas:
Cleaning: Use mild soap and water to clean up the surface area. Avoid abrasive cleaners that can scratch the material.
Inspect Seals: Regularly inspect door seals for wear and tear, replacing them when essential for optimal insulation.
Lubricate Hardware: Keep locks and hinges lubed to ensure smooth operation.
Prevent Direct Sunlight: If possible, set up doors where they are protected from direct sunlight to avoid fading.
Often Asked Questions (FAQs)What is the life-span of uPVC door panels?
uPVC door panels usually have a life expectancy of 20 to 30 years, depending on the installation and maintenance.
Are uPVC door panels more pricey than wooden doors?
While the initial expense might be similar, the long-lasting cost savings associated with uPVC, such as minimized maintenance and energy effectiveness, frequently make them more economical.
Can uPVC panels be painted or stained?
uPVC panels can be painted with specialized paints, however they can not be stained like wood. The majority of uPVC panels can be found in different colors and finishes.
How do uPVC panels compare to composite doors?
UPVC Door Panel Solutions panels are usually lower in cost and maintenance however might do not have the timeless aesthetic of composite doors that mimic wood.
Is uPVC eco-friendly?
While uPVC is an artificial product, many manufacturers are now producing environmentally friendly choices made from recycled products and recyclable products.
